    Abstract: The present invention comprises a communication device configured to communicate using several wireless networking protocols. The communication device is configured to transmit a signal according to a first protocol so as to indicate to devices on the wireless network that they should not transmit during a first period of time, and subsequently, transmit or receive signals by means of the second protocol during the first period of time.

    Abstract: A method of measuring a very low frequencycomponent of a signal is described. The method comprises sampling the signal at random timesto generate a "decimated" signal, and then filtering the decimated signal using a low-passfilter. There are many different methods which may be used to sample the signal at random times, and in one example, a sample of the signal may be taken and then passed to the low-passfilter with a probability of1/M, where M is the decimation factor.

    Abstract: Methods of spectral partitioning which may be implemented in an encoder are described. The methods comprise determining an estimateof bit requirements for each of a plurality of spectral sub-bands. These estimates are then used to group the sub-bands into two or more regions by minimising a cost function. This cost function is based on the estimates ofbit requirements for each sub-band and the estimates may include estimates of code bit requirements and / or additional code bit requirements for each sub-band. These estimates may be determined in many different ways and a number of methods are described.
